Leg-spinner Yuzvendra Chahal returned to One Day Internationals in style during the opening encounter of the 3-match series against Sri Lanka on Sunday in Colombo. Playing an ODI for India after a gap of seven months, Chahal picked up a wicket off the very first ball he bowled in the game.

Sri Lankan openers Avishka Fernando and Minod Bhanuka went off to a decent start after the hosts opted to bat first. They stitched a 49-run stand for the first wicket before Chahal got the breakthrough for the visitors.

The leg-spinner came to bowl the 10th over after Buvneshwar Kumar and Deepak Chahar opened India’s bowling attack. Chahal bowled a tossed-up leg break and Avishka chipped it straight to the Manish Pandey who was posted at the cover. Sri Lanka were reduced to 49 for 1 and the opener was out for 32 off 35 deliveries. (India vs Sri Lanka 1st ODI Live)

Earlier, Sri Lanka had won the toss and opted to bat. Indian captain Shikhar Dhawan, who is captaining the Indian team for the first time, said that attacking batsman Prithvi Shaw will open with him. Moreover, it’s the first time since the ICC Cricket World Cup 2019 that the spin duo of Kuldeep Yadav and Yuzvendra Chahal is coming back in the line-up.

The match also witnessed Suryakumar Yadav and Ishan Kishan make their ODI debuts. They began their international careers promisingly earlier this year in T20Is against England at home.
